Looking at your backtrace, the culprit is here: https://github.com/rails/rails/blob/v3.0.13/actionpack/lib/abstract_controller/helpers.rb#L123 Rails is trying to include your class as a helper module but it is not a module. For validation, compare the error you're getting to what you get in IRB with code like: Class.new { include Class.new } Anyhow, it would take me a while to dig through the entire backtrace to see exactly how it is getting there, but I suspect that rails' support for testing helpers assumes that helpers are modules, and tries to mix them in to a testable object, the same way rails does to mix helper modules into a template context. rspec-rails generally wraps what rails provides, so when you tag your example group with `:type => :helper` it is triggering this. I recommend trying to not tag your example group with `:type => :helper`. After all, this isn't a helper module, right?
